According to Wikipedia, Mark Samuel Nelkin is a theoretical physicist at the Cornell University. Under the direction of Professor Hans Bethe, he received his Ph.D. in theoretical physics from Cornell in 1955. From 1955 to 1962 he worked in the nuclear industry for General Electric in Schenectady and General Atomic in San Diego. In 1962 he became a member of the Cornell faculty. He was awarded a Guggenheim Fellowship in 1968. He retired from Cornell University as professor emeritus in 1993. After retirement he moved to New York City and remained active in refereeing articles for Physical Review Letters, Physical Review E, The Physics of Fluids, and the Journal of Fluid Mechanics.
